What to Discover Before You Buy A Fence
If you want to protect yourself so you get the best deal and fence you want, then take the time to do some research. So first ask yourself what is most important to you because that's the most important thing. Maybe you have the family pet or pets, and you need a fence for them, but there are other purposes, too. If you have a pond or fountain setup in your garden, then consider a fence that is ornamental, and then you can make your landscaping look much more attractive.
Most families like a fence around the garden for various reasons, and this can become a real plus when you put your house up for sale. So when you are choosing fence materials, you really don't want to go with something that is cheap and unpleasant to look at. And if you are concerned about security for your garden and home, then think about combining that plus aesthetics. But with a privacy fence, they tend to be tall and you may want to talk to your neighbors about that and check zoning laws.
If you want to do more with your fence, or have it serve more than one purpose, then the ornamental type of fencing is in order. You would be surprised at the number of ornamental fencing styles and designs, and they're worth a serious look.
As a baseline for security fences, you will find them in any height you want but typically no higher than 8 feet. The reason you need to be aware is that there may be ordinances or zoning laws to deal with. What you'll find is there may be restrictions on the height of a security fence, and if you have neighbors, then they may object to a metal fence that is eight feet tall. These are the little annoyances that are just part of the legal aspects of home improvement projects, so just smile and deal with it and move on.
